Kabale District Chairperson Suspended After Heated Budget Meeting Showdown.

The Kabale District Speaker Flavia Nyinakiiza Kanagizi yesterday suspended the District Chairperson Nelson Nshangabasheija from attending the next two council sessions, following a series of confrontations during the 2026/2027 budget finalization meetings.

Nyinakiiza said the decision was prompted by Nshangabasheija’s refusal to present the budget, as he insisted that the council first approve his nominees for the District Public Accounts Committee and the District Land Board. The situation escalated when Nyinakiiza called for the budget to be tabled, but Nshangabasheija’s shouted demands disrupted the proceedings, forcing a ten-minute suspension.

When the session reconvened, Nshangabasheija remained outside the chamber and refused to rejoin the debate. With the council’s work stalled, the District Vice-Chairperson Miria Tugume stepped in to present the budget after waiting for the chairperson’s return proved futile.

Speaker Nyinakiiza noted that the suspension is intended to preserve the decorum and efficiency of council business.
